From the day of your birth,
You had a special purpose here on earth.
Although you only lived three short years,
Your death still brings forth tears.

We only met for two short weeks,
But I still remember your rosy cheeks.
You had so much fun,
Playing ball in the sun.

That all changed that December day,
When God called you away.
Even with the passing of time,
You are still on our minds.

As part of your family, we can only pray,
That we will be together someday.
You are my Guardian Angel from above,
And to you, Christopher, I send my love.

Watching over me everyday,
I feel your presense in a special way.
God put you where he wants you to be,
Please,Christopher, continue to watch over me.


Cathy Bohannan


Poem was written in loving memory of nephew.
